-* Renesas JPEG Processing Unit
-
-The JPEG processing unit (JPU) incorporates the JPEG codec with an encoding
-and decoding function conforming to the JPEG baseline process, so that the JPU
-can encode image data and decode JPEG data quickly.
-
-Required properties:
-- compatible: "renesas,jpu-<soctype>", "renesas,rcar-gen2-jpu" as fallback.
- Examples with soctypes are:
- - "renesas,jpu-r8a7790" for R-Car H2
- - "renesas,jpu-r8a7791" for R-Car M2-W
- - "renesas,jpu-r8a7792" for R-Car V2H
- - "renesas,jpu-r8a7793" for R-Car M2-N
-
- - reg: Base address and length of the registers block for the JPU.
- - interrupts: JPU interrupt specifier.
- - clocks: A phandle + clock-specifier pair for the JPU functional clock.
-
-Example: R8A7790 (R-Car H2) JPU node
- jpeg-codec@fe980000 {
- compatible = "renesas,jpu-r8a7790", "renesas,rcar-gen2-jpu";
- reg = <0 0xfe980000 0 0x10300>;
- interrupts = <0 272 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
- clocks = <&mstp1_clks R8A7790_CLK_JPU>;
- };
